GOP lawmaker joins Democrat-led effort to limit Trump's pardon power
GOP Rep. Don Bacon supports a Democrat-led constitutional amendment to create congressional oversight of presidential pardons following President Trump’s recent NFL pardons.
This story is significant because it addresses the checks and balances on presidential power, specifically the controversial and often unchecked authority to grant pardons. Concerns about the potential for abuse, political influence, or transactional exchanges in clemency decisions have led to calls for reform, highlighting ongoing debates about the integrity of the justice system and executive authority.
